| def sample_vocab(tokens: Iterable[str], vocab_size: Optional[int] = None, | |
| vocab_coverage: Optional[float] = None) -> List[str]: | |
| assert (vocab_size is not None and vocab_coverage is None) or \ | |
| (vocab_size is None and vocab_coverage is not None), "vocab_size [or] vocab_coverage need specified" | |
| token_count = {} | |
| for c in tokens: | |
| token_count[c] = token_count.get(c, 0) + 1 | |
| if vocab_size is not None: | |
| token_count = list(token_count.items()) | |
| token_count.sort(key=lambda i: i[1], reverse=True) | |
| vocab = [c[0] for c in token_count[:vocab_size]] | |
| else: | |
| total_count = sum(token_count.values()) | |
| token_freq = [(c, i / total_count) for c, i in token_count.items()] | |
| token_freq.sort(key=lambda i: i[1], reverse=True) | |
| freq_sum = 0.0 | |
| split = 0 | |
| for split in range(len(token_freq)): | |
| freq_sum += token_freq[split][1] | |
| if freq_sum >= vocab_coverage: | |
| break | |
| vocab = [c[0] for c in token_freq[:split + 1]] | |
| return vocab | |

| class TRIETokenizer: | |
| def split_bytes(data: bytes): | |
| return [b'%c' % i for i in data] | |
| def __init__(self, vocab_file: str): | |
| self.nodes = [(b'', -1, -1, [-1 for _ in range(256)])] # node value, parent index, token id, children | |
| with open(vocab_file, 'r') as file: | |
| vocabs = json.load(file) | |
| vocabs.sort(key=lambda i: len(i['bytes'])) | |
| for entry in vocabs: | |
| self.add_vocab(bytes(entry['bytes']), entry['id']) | |
| self.id_to_bytes = {i['id']: i['bytes'] for i in vocabs} | |
| def add_vocab(self, vocab_bytes: bytes, vocab_id: int): | |
| cur_node_idx = 0 | |
| for i, b in enumerate(vocab_bytes): | |
| cur_node = self.nodes[cur_node_idx] | |
| if cur_node[3][b] != -1: | |
| cur_node_idx = cur_node[3][b] | |
| else: | |
| new_node_idx = len(self.nodes) | |
| self.nodes.append((vocab_bytes, cur_node_idx, vocab_id if i == len(vocab_bytes) - 1 else -1, | |
| [-1 for _ in range(256)])) | |
| cur_node[3][b] = new_node_idx | |
| cur_node_idx = new_node_idx | |
| def attempt_match(self, match_bytes: bytes): | |
| match_length, match_token_id = -1, -1 | |
| cur_node_idx, depth = 0, 0 | |
| for i, b in enumerate(match_bytes): | |
| match_node_idx = self.nodes[cur_node_idx][3][b] | |
| if match_node_idx == -1: | |
| break | |
| cur_node = self.nodes[match_node_idx] | |
| if cur_node[2] != -1: | |
| match_length = depth | |
| match_token_id = cur_node[2] | |
| cur_node_idx = match_node_idx | |
| depth += 1 | |
| return match_length, match_token_id | |
| def encode(self, text: str): | |
| text_bytes = text.encode('utf-8') | |
| tokens, length = [], 0 | |
| while length < len(text_bytes): | |
| offset, token_id = self.attempt_match(text_bytes[length:]) | |
| assert offset >= 0 | |
| tokens.append(token_id) | |
| length += offset + 1 | |
| return tokens | |
| def decode(self, token_ids: List[int]): | |
| return bytes([t for i in token_ids for t in self.id_to_bytes[i]]).decode('utf-8', errors='replace') | |
| def get_vocab_size(self): | |
| return len(self.id_to_bytes) | |
